The ingredients needed to make Instant Pot Filipino Beef Steak (Bistek):
Get 1 lb boneless ribeye steak, sliced thinly
Prepare 1/4 cup soy sauce
Prepare 3 tbsp calamansi juice (or lemon juice OR vinegar)
Take 1 tsp freshly cracked black pepper
Prepare 2 large onions
Get 3 tbsp oil divided in two
Prepare 2 tsp sugar
Get pinch salt to taste
Instructions to make Instant Pot Filipino Beef Steak (Bistek):
In a large bowl, throw in the steak, soy sauce, calamansi juice, and black pepper. Mix all the ingredients together, then let it sit for at least 30 minutes to marinade (or overnight).
Take two large onions, peel the skin off, and slice them into thick rings.
Plug in your instant pot, and press Saute and keep it on Normal mode. Allow it to heat up for a few minutes, then pour in oil and sautee the onion rings until translucent.
Heat up oil and fry marinated meat for 3-5 minutes.
Dump in the meat and the marinade inside the instant pot. Add a pinch of salt to taste, stir it up, and put the Instant Pot lid on. Make sure that the vent is pointed towards “Sealing”.
Press “cancel” to turn off the Saute mode, and press “Pressure Cook”, keeping it on Normal. Make sure your pressure level is on High Pressure, and then set the time for 7 minutes.
After the 7 minutes, use oven mitts or a long spatula to release the pressure from the vent. After all the pressure has been released, you can open the lid safely.
Press “Cancel” and “Saute” mode to let it simmer while you taste the sauce. Add the sugar and more salt if needed to taste.
Turn off the Instant Pot, and serve your bistek with a side of white rice!
